But if you really wanna go through with it, a flip-out 7" should fit in the console fine. A non-flipping regular 7" monitor will require you to do some fancy customizing. Here's someone with a 5.6" mounted in the console...
https://www.honda-acura.net/forums/s...ad.php?t=41954
Depending on how much bigger your screen is, you might not be able to mount your deck underneath it. If not, you could mount it in the armrest.
